Apartment living in Hall County caters to a range of lifestyle needs. Studio units typically rent in the $900 range, while one‑bedroom apartments are commonly found in the $1,200‑$1,300 bracket. Larger families often opt for two‑bedroom units, which generally command rents around $1,500, and three‑bedroom layouts are available at approximately $1,600. Property Type | Bedrooms | Average | Median | Min - Max | 25th - 75th |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Apartment | Studio | $973 | $1,100 | $695 - $1,125 | $695 - $1,125 |
Apartment | 1 Bedroom | $1,249 | $1,277 | $600 - $1,895 | $1,050 - $1,375 |
Apartment | 2 Bedroom | $1,498 | $1,500 | $925 - $2,395 | $1,219 - $1,665 |
Apartment | 3 Bedroom | $1,616 | $1,250 | $1,075 - $2,995 | $1,100 - $1,830 |
In the current period, the average rent in Hall was
$973 for Studio,
$1,239 for 1 Bedroom,
$1,498 for 2 Bedroom, and
$1,644 for 3 Bedroom.
Note: This analysis includes only bedroom types with sufficient data.
